US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"for extended measures"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in contexts where you are referring to actions, assessments, or evaluations that are prolonged or thorough in nature. Example: "The committee decided to implement new protocols for extended measures to ensure the safety of all participants during the event."

Ludwig's WRAP-UP

In summary, the phrase "for extended measures" is a grammatically sound prepositional phrase used to indicate the implementation of thorough or prolonged actions. While considered correct by Ludwig AI, the phrase benefits from contextual clarity to avoid ambiguity. Alternatives like "for prolonged measures" or "for comprehensive measures" may offer more precision depending on the intended meaning. The register is generally neutral, fitting various professional and informative contexts. It's important to define 'extended' clearly to ensure effective communication.
